Once the cake is cool to the touch you can attempt to take it out of the pan. Find out how to get stuck cake out of a pan without ruining your dessert. Learn how to get cake out of a pan efficiently. If the edges are stuck to the sides of the pan, slide a sharp knife all the way around the perimeter of the cake, making sure the knife touches the bottom.
